Fisher F75SE Hidden Program

goldman55

Member
Got your attention on that Heading. Was out today at local Park pretty Trashy been Hit alot. I started doing this last year late, got gold well today spend over 4hr working this. I was shocked by the results. The machine was GB at about 58 with ground Grab,

Stetting was --PF mode---80 sens---15 recrimination---3 tones---notch at 40. OK on a air test Dime 7" but strong if you go past the 7 " air test nothing, no tailing of the coin getting weaker it just stops's. Same with other coins some Gold Ring's. But in the Ground a Big Wake up Call. Scanning the ground f75 quit i mean sometime had to put a coin down to make sure it was working. Nickel hit strong showed 13" on the depth dug their was the nickel at just little over 111" had my wooden ruler with me. Hit on a piece of Tab i mean size of lest then a pea strong ,showed it was a tab it was down 8" i mean small piece. Found a small dog tag 9&1/2" down same with a dime. My finds increased 2 fold when using this Mode compared to the other modes didn't try the Cl mode.Had my F75 about 1yr now love it. By the Way i was using the fisher 5" coil. The air test doesn't even come close when the metal is in the ground. Just thought i would share this. On this mode its bang hit no ifee's

I know he had a typo, but I took his settings like this'

PF mode
Sensitivity @ 80
Disc at 15
Tones 3
Notch at 40 which is only half of tabs, with disc set at 15 and a notch at 40 you would be notching out half of the tabs.

Hope I am right, the machine was running quiet.

I've got both and the E Trac is a deep, stable machine not effected by EMI like the 75 is. I can hunt under major power towers and not a bit of problem even with the sensitivity cranked up. The ONLY problem with the ET is the weight. It does get heavy on the marathon hunts I do. I am just learning the 75 and my main use will be in parks. The multi-tones of the ET does make for a learning curve but when you hit silver you will love the tone it makes. I was out all day Saturday learning the 75 at a school field.
